2005 Hyundai Sonata vs. 1960 Nissan Cedric
To start off, 2005 Hyundai Sonata is newer by 45 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1960 Nissan Cedric.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1960 Nissan Cedric would be higher. At 2,343 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Hyundai Sonata is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Hyundai Sonata (138 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 78 more horse power than 1960 Nissan Cedric. (60 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Hyundai Sonata should accelerate faster than 1960 Nissan Cedric.
Let's talk about torque, 2005 Hyundai Sonata (199 Nm) has 83 more torque (in Nm) than 1960 Nissan Cedric. (116 Nm). This means 2005 Hyundai Sonata will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1960 Nissan Cedric.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Hyundai Sonata | 1960 Nissan Cedric | |
Make | Hyundai | Nissan |
Model | Sonata | Cedric |
Year Released | 2005 | 1960 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2343 cc | 1488 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 138 HP | 60 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Torque | 199 Nm | 116 Nm |
Vehicle Length | 4750 mm | 4420 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1830 mm | 1690 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1530 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2540 mm |
